Tree-Climbing Lion in Lake Manyara 2027: the Ndala Fig-Tree Pride and the Best Time for the Observation

The Lake Manyara tree-climbing lion is the Tanzania safari’s most unusual wildlife behavior — the lion species’ typical non-arboreal nature making the Manyara lion’s documented fig-tree resting behavior a locally-acquired learned behavior that has been passed from generation to generation within the Manyara pride structure since at least the 1962 Schaller documentation. The 2027 tree-climbing lion ecology: the Manyara’s Ndala River forest zone hosts 2 to 3 resident lion prides , the tree-climbing behavior most reliably observed in the Ndala River’s large sycomore fig trees . The best time for the tree-climbing lion in 2027: the June to October dry season is the 2027 recommended tree-climbing lion period for 3 converging reasons — the 8 to 12 degree Celsius temperature differential between the 3 to 5 meter fig-tree canopy and the 38 to 44 degree ground at 12:00 to 15:00 PM creates the strongest behavioral incentive for the lion’s arboreal rest in the dry season’s peak heat ; the dry season’s reduced foliage ; and the dry-season concentrates the lion in the forest zone . Lake Manyara Flamingo and Birding 2027: Alkaline Lake Spectacle, Groundwater Forest Circuit and the January-February Peak

Lake Manyara’s dual ornithological attraction — the alkaline lake’s flamingo concentration and the groundwater forest’s forest-species diversity — makes Manyara the Tanzania safari circuit’s most birding-productive single-park half-day or full-day addition. The 2027 flamingo calendar: the lesser flamingo population at Lake Manyara is determined by the lake’s alkalinity and cyanobacteria fusiformis] concentration — the flamingo’s primary food source — which peaks in the post-rain seasons when the rains’ nutrient input stimulates the cyanobacteria bloom on the 15 to 25 centimeter shallow feeding zone. The 2027 peak flamingo forecast: the January 15 to March 5 period and the June 15 to August 15 period are the 2027 projected flamingo peak windows at Lake Manyara — the typical peak count of 50,000 to 90,000 lesser flamingo visible as a 3 to 8 kilometer pink-white band at the lake’s southern and eastern shoreline from the main road’s lookout point at 2 to 3 kilometers distance. The groundwater forest birding circuit in 2027: the Manyara gate’s groundwater forest zone runs 6 to 8 kilometers from the main park gate to the Hippo Pool — the 3 to 4 hour slow-drive forest circuit identifies 100 to 140 resident species in the dry season and 130 to 165 species in the November-April migrant season. The 2027 forest birding highlights : the African broadbill — the forest’s cryptic understorey resident producing the mechanical wing-flutter “prrrp” display that guides birding observers to the 12 to 15 centimeter bird in the 4 to 8 meter undergrowth canopy; the narina trogon — the 28 to 34 centimeter brilliant-green trogon at the 5 to 12 meter height in the fig and mahogany canopy; the silvery-cheeked hornbill — the 70 to 80 centimeter hornbill in the canopy fig trees; and the Manyara’s documented 6 species of kingfisher along the forest’s stream courses .

Lake Manyara 2027 Practical: Day Trip vs Overnight, Rate and the Ngorongoro Circuit Integration

Lake Manyara’s 325 square kilometer total park area is most commonly visited as a half-day to full-day addition to the Ngorongoro Crater and Tarangire circuit. The Manyara day trip versus overnight decision: the Manyara day trip from Arusha allows the 06:00 AM park entry, the 3-hour morning game drive, and the 11:00 AM departure for the Ngorongoro descent — the day trip format sufficient for the tree-climbing lion and flamingo observation but not for the evening game-drive . The overnight Manyara: the Lake Manyara Serena Lodge and the Lake Manyara Tree Lodge allow the 06:00 AM and the 16:30 PM game drive within the park, providing the full-day wildlife observation that the day-trip format misses. The Manyara 2027 rate: the Lake Manyara Tree Lodge at USD 550 to 780 per person per night; the Lake Manyara Serena Lodge at USD 250 to 420 per person per night; and the budget-tier lodges outside the park at USD 80 to 150 per person per night are the 3 accommodation tiers. The Ngorongoro circuit integration: Manyara is most effectively combined with the Ngorongoro Crater and Tarangire in the 5 to 7 day northern Tanzania circuit that visits all 3 parks.
